Conjunctions - and, but, or

  • He wanted to climb a tree (and / but / or) it was too high.
    but
  • You can wait longer (and / but / or) come back tomorrow.
    or
  • Mary went to the gym + Her friend went to the gym
    Mary and her friend went to the gym.
  • I want a new PS5 + It is expensive
    I want a new PS5 but it is expensive.
  • Do you want to sleep (and / but / or) play?
    or
  • The farmer planted many seeds (and / but / or) nothing grew in the drought.
    but
  • You must study (and / but / or) you can fail the test.
    or
  • He saved the baby bird (and / but / or) it flew away again.
    but
  • They will visit Phuket + They will visit Krabi
    They will visit Phuket and Krabi.
  • Please use a pencil (and / but / or) ruler to draw a square.
    and
  • They all had pizza (and / but / or) juice for lunch.
    and
  • We planted a tree (and / but / or) watered it.
    and
  • Her mother (and / but / or) father took a trip last week.
    and
  • She is very good in class + She always listens to the teacher.
    She is very good in class and always listens to the teacher.
  • He likes chicken + He doesn't like fish
    He likes chicken, but he doesn't like fish.
  • We could go to Europe (and / but / or) America last holiday.
    or
  • Do you want a sandwich? + Do you want fries?
    Do you want a sandwich or fries?
  • Mom drove me to school + The car broke down
    Mom drove me to school but the car broke down.
  • The thief tried to escape (and / but / or) he was caught by police.
    but
  • They were singing + They were dancing
    They were singing and dancing.
  • Do you like reading (and / but / or) watching TV?
    or
  • Is he your brother? + Is he your friend?
    Is he your brother or your friend?
  • Please buy bread (and / but / or) butter to make sandwiches.
    and
